What is a Socket Weld Flange?
Before delving into the benefits, it's important to understand what a socket weld flange actually is. A socket weld flange features a socket-like recess that allows the pipe to be inserted into the flange, providing a strong, secure connection. This design is particularly beneficial for use in high-pressure systems. The welding process typically involves fillet welding, which enhances its structural integrity. Socket weld flanges are often used in applications that require a leak-proof joint and are prevalent in industries such as oil and gas, chemicals, and shipbuilding.
Benefits of Socket Weld Flanges
1. Enhanced Strength and Durability
One of the most significant advantages of the Socket Weld Flange is its strength. Because the pipe fits directly into the flange, the joint created is capable of withstanding high pressure and stress. This makes socket weld flanges an excellent choice for high-pressure systems, ensuring the longevity and reliability of the piping infrastructure.
2. Compact Design
Socket weld flanges offer a compact profile, which is beneficial in tight spaces where a thicker flange could pose an installation challenge. The minimalist design allows for a neat and tidy arrangement of pipes, making socket weld flanges a preferred option in industries where space constraints are an issue.
3. Reduced Risk of Leakage
Another primary benefit of socket weld flanges is the reduced risk of leakage. The design allows for a stronger weld joint, which minimizes the chances of fluid escaping from the connection. This feature is critical in high-pressure and high-temperature environments, where leaks can lead to dangerous situations or costly downtime.
4. Ease of Installation
Socket weld flanges are relatively easy to install, particularly for skilled welders. The simple process of inserting the pipe into the flange and performing a weld makes it a time-efficient option. This ease of installation contributes to lower labor costs and faster project completion times.
5. Versatile Applications
Socket weld flanges can be used across a variety of applications. From water supply systems to petrochemical processing, the versatility of the Socket Weld Flange makes it suitable for many environments. Industries such as power generation, pharmaceuticals, and food processing also utilize these flanges due to their reliability and strong performance.
